What Is an Emergency Locksmith for Cars?
An emergency situation locksmith for cars is a specialized expert trained to deal with lock-related problems in vehicles. These experts are equipped with the latest tools and innovations to unlock, rekey, or replace car locks effectively and successfully. Unlike conventional locksmith professionals who mostly focus on home and commercial locks, auto locksmith professionals have a deep understanding of the special lock systems used in numerous makes and models of automobiles.

Losing your car keys can be a headache, particularly if you have no spare. An emergency locksmith can produce a new key utilizing the vehicle's serial number or a pre-existing key fob.
Broken Key in the Lock
If your key breaks off in the lock, it can be hard to remove without the right tools. A locksmith can securely extract the broken key and repair or replace the lock if essential.
Key Fob Malfunction
Electronic key fobs can fail due to battery issues or internal element failures. An emergency situation locksmith can diagnose the problem and program a new fob or replace the battery.
Lock Cylinder Jamming
Often, the lock cylinder can become jammed due to use and tear or debris. A locksmith can clean up or replace the cylinder to get your car back to regular.
Trunk Lockout
If you've inadvertently locked your type in the trunk, a locksmith can utilize customized tools to open it without causing damage to the vehicle.

Q: How much does an emergency situation locksmith service cost?
A: The cost can vary depending on the service needed, the time of day, and the area. Typically, anticipate to pay in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200 for emergency situation services. Some locksmiths use flat rates for particular services, so it's an excellent idea to ask for an expense estimate before they begin work.
